In the normal sow, milk ejection from the teats starts about one to three minutes following initiation of nursing behavior (which occurs about once each hour in early lactation). The farrowing quarters need to provide two different microclimates: a cool one for the sow (60-65F) and a hot one for the newborn piglets (85-95F the first few days, then decreased to the 70-80F range). Sulawesi warty pigs (Sus celebensis) and Palawan bearded pigs (Sus ahoenobarbus) are listed as "near threatened"; Philippine warty pigs (Sus philippensis) are "vulnerable"; Javan warty pigs (Sus verrucosus) are "endangered"; and Visayan warty pigs are "critically endangered." For example, red river hogs (Potamochoerus porcus), also called bush pigs, are found in Africa; babirusas (Babyrousa babyrussa), or pig deer, are found in Indonesia; and Visayan warty pigs (Sus cebifrons) come from the Philippines. Wild boars, for example, fill the majority of their diet with roots, seeds, bulbs and green plants, according to the Woodland Trust, however as opportunistic feeders they will also chow down on invertebrates, carrion (decaying flesh) and even small mammals found on the forest floor. Once pregnant, female pigs, commonly called sows, carry a litter of around 10 piglets for approximately 114 days before giving birth, according to the animal welfare organisation Compassion in World Farming. Within the first six hours piglets suckle the "first milk", also known as colostrum, which is jam-packed with nutrients and essential antibodies to build the piglet's immune system.
